Best time to go to Roeschwoog

The best time to visit Roeschwoog can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Roeschwoog fal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Roeschwoog fal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January35.2°F (1.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April50.9°F (10.5°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
May57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June65.5°F (18.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July68.7°F (20.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August68.2°F (20.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
September61.0°F (16.1°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October52.5°F (11.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November43.7°F (6.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
December37.9°F (3.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High

Where can I find the best nightlife in Roeschwoog?
Roeschwoog, a charming village in the Grand Est region of France, is more known for its picturesque countryside than for a bustling nightlife scene.

If you're looking for vibrant nightlife, nearby cities such as Strasbourg or Mulhouse are your best bets. Strasbourg, in particular, boasts a lively atmosphere with a variety of bars, clubs, and outdoor cafés along the historic streets of La Petite France. Here, you can enjoy everything from trendy wine bars to lively dance clubs.

In Mulhouse, you'll find a mix of pubs and music venues, offering live performances and a friendly, welcoming vibe. Both cities are easily accessible and provide a wonderful alternative if you're keen on experiencing the nightlife while staying in the more tranquil setting of Roeschwoog.
